1. Start By Considering Current "Forks"

According to Fork Theory, which is derived from the idiom "Stick a fork in me, I'm done," forks are the minor and major stressors that build up over the course of a day. Applying this to the homeownership of Denver real estate, what are the areas of minor (or major!) annoyance you've been putting off fixing? For example, are your vents or electrical outlets placed in areas that are inconvenient for modern home buyers of Denver homes for sale? Over the years, furniture styles and room purposes have evolved, so spaces designed for homeowners decades ago may need some design upgrades to be more functional today. By identifying known issues you have not yet fixed, you have a place to start your improvements without feeling too overwhelmed by all the possible upgrades you can make.

2. Kitchen

For the kitchen, consider how many appliances the typical home cook needs. Does your kitchen have enough plugs to support countertop appliances like the coffee machine, blender, mixer, toaster, etc. all at once? Is there enough counter space for these machines as well as for food preparation? If not, you might want to consider an addition or reconfiguration in your Denver real estate. Other key kitchen features that can add value are a new dishwasher, double ovens, and two stovetops. It is also worth considering the age of your cabinets and countertop. If they are in poor shape or look like they belong in a different era, it may be time to refurbish or replace them. If your Denver real estate currently lacks any of these features, they may be worth considering when making these upgrades.

An island is also a great way to increase the functionality of your kitchen. If you have the space, adding an island can give you extra counter and storage space. It can also provide a place to eat in the kitchen or serve as a homework station for kids, which appeals to families interested in Denver homes for sale.

Another way to improve the function of your kitchen is by updating the layout. If your current layout is inefficient or inconvenient, then it may be time for a change. This is a more significant upgrade that will require the help of a professional, but it can make a big difference in how you use and enjoy your kitchen.

3. Bathroom

In the bathroom, the most common improvements that see a high return on investment among Denver real estate are increasing the size of the shower, adding a double sink vanity, and installing heated floors. If you have a small bathroom, you may want to consider reconfiguring the layout to make better use of the space. For example, you could move the toilet to a different location or add a storage closet.

For the shower, in addition to increasing the size, adding recessed nooks for shower accessories is a popular upgrade. Buyers also appreciate rainwater-inspired shower heads or the addition of one or more extra showerheads.

Aside from the heated flooring, other amenity upgrades buyers adore include entertainment elements such as a sound system, television, or fireplace to be enjoyed while relaxing in the bath.

4. Bedrooms

When it comes to luxurious bedroom improvements, there are a few that stand out as being particularly high-value for buyers interested in Denver homes for sale. Installing a new ceiling fan is a great way to start. Not only does it add a touch of luxury, but it can also help you save on your energy bills.

Another popular upgrade is installing a fireplace. Not only is this a great way to add value to your home, but it can also make your bedroom more comfortable and inviting. If you don't have the space for a traditional fireplace, there are many electric options that can give you the same look and feel without the need for extensive renovations.

If you have the space, adding a walk-in closet is another great way to add value to your home. This is a particularly desirable feature for buyers who have a lot of clothes or are looking for extra storage space.

Finally, if you're looking for a luxurious upgrade that will really wow buyers, consider adding a sitting area to your bedroom. This can be a great place to relax and can really make your bedroom feel like a retreat.

5. Office

If your Denver real estate doesn't already have one, adding a dedicated office space is a feature today's buyers especially appreciate. This is a great way to add value to your home and make it more attractive to potential buyers of Denver homes for sale.

When adding an office, there are a few things you'll want to keep in mind. First, consider the size of the space. You'll want to make sure it's large enough to comfortably fit a desk, chair, and any other furniture you plan on adding. Second, pay attention to the lighting. You'll want to make sure the space is well-lit so you can work comfortably. Finally, think about acoustics. If you live in a noisy area or have family members who are often home during the day, you may want to consider soundproofing the space.

If your home already has a home office, consider upgrades that would make your own working-from-home experience easier. Does the room have enough plugs? Does the whole home have surge protection? Have you considered a generator to allow you to keep working even if the power goes out?

6. Home Addition

One of the highest ticket items that can bring in a high return on investment is adding an extra story or extension on the ground floor. This can be a great way to add value to your home and make it more attractive to potential buyers.

When adding an extra story or first-floor expansion, there are a few things you'll want to keep in mind. First, consider the structure of your property. Consult with an architect and building firm to determine the feasibility of the project and to get an estimate of the costs. Be sure to consider the type of space that would most benefit your family and future buyers. Does adding space provide you with the room for a home office, a recreation room, or even an in-law suite? Having a tentative design idea in mind when you consult the architect is wise. Be sure you have the necessary permits and approvals from your local municipality before starting construction. Adding an extra story or first-floor expansion can be a big project, but it can really pay off when it comes time to sell your home.
